On Friday, February 8, 2002, gold was priced at C$13,173.12 per kilogram in Canadian Dollars, based on a CAD spot price of C$409.73 per troy ounce. One troy ounce equals 0.0311035 kilograms. The daily trading range was C$13,142.57 to C$13,342.23 per kg, a spread of C$199.66.

Compared to the previous trading session, gold per kilogram rose by C$164.93 (+1.27%). Kilogram gold bars are a popular choice among Canadian institutional investors, pension funds, and those looking to make larger bullion purchases. The Royal Canadian Mint offers kilo bars in 99.99% purity, which are LBMA-approved and recognized worldwide.

In 2002, gold in CAD traded between C$375.44 and C$471.42, with an annual average of C$419.14. This day's price was -2.2% below the yearly average and -13.1% from the year's high.
